The Autotrader Best New Cars Award is intended to benefit a broad set of shoppers by highlighting a diverse group of 12 vehicles. Each vehicle on this year’s list was agreed upon unanimously by the entire editorial and data team at Autotrader. To be considered, a vehicle must be of the current or next model-year and available for purchase at the time of the announcement. The editors capped the base price for consideration at  ₦28.4 million (although most vehicles on the list are well under), meaning they offer significant value for the asking price. Not only was value a top priority, but vehicles also were judged on available technology and rewarding or dynamic driving experience. Each winning car had to score an overall 3.9 or higher on the editors’ 5-point evaluation sheet.

2020 Kia Telluride

2020 Kia Telluride Prices, Reviews, and Pictures in Nigeria

The Kia Telluride is one of the Best New Cars of 2020, according to Autotrader.  The honor is just the latest accolade for Kia’s bold and boxy SUV, which continues to earn acclaim for segment leadership, innovation, design, safety, driver satisfaction, and overall value.

2020 Mazda CX-30

2020 Mazda CX-30
2020 Mazda CX-30

Shoehorned between the CX-3 and CX-5, the new Mazda CX-30 is a unique take on Mazda’s classic crossover formula. Using the new Mazda3 as its base, the CX-30 borrows the same 2.5-liter engine and six-speed automatic transmission, as well as the Mazda3’s same updated cabin, as well. The CX-30 is currently on sale and costs 9 million Naira to start. Mazda has built a reputation for building athletic SUVs in segments where performance and handling are normally missing. You won’t get bored behind the wheel of any new Mazda model, including the CX-30. “If you are in the market for a small crossover but still want particularly good handling, this could be the vehicle for you,” Ben said of the new Mazda.

2020 Toyota Highlander

2020 Toyota Highlander
2020 Toyota Highlander

The third midsize 3-row crossover from a volume brand on our list this year is the all-new 2020 Toyota Highlander. The Highlander is a good SUV and has been a leader in this segment since it was first introduced almost 20 years ago and its dominance continues with the freshly redesigned fourth generation.

Toyota introduced an all-new Highlander as three-row crossovers remain sales kings. The all-new model, which rides on the Toyota New Global Architecture (TNGA)) family, presents an evolutionary design that’s familiar, borrowing from the RAV4 and Avalon. There are two powertrains – gas or gas-electric hybrid. The 3.5-liter V6 carries over unchanged. The hybrid uses a 2.5-liter four-cylinder instead of the previous gen’s 3.5-liter V6. The hybrid’s Horsepower is down, but it makes up for it with improved fuel economy.

2020 Subaru Outback

2020 Subaru Outback

The all new 2020 Subaru Outback is a very good family car. Subaru intentionally didn’t mess with the look too much because Subaru people like the Subaru look. However, when you step inside, the redesign becomes much more apparent. Naturally, AWD is standard on every trim which, combined with generous ground clearance and Subaru’s X-Mode, gives the Outback some serious off-road chops while still being a pleasure to drive on the road.

2020 Hyundai Sonata

2020 Hyundai Sonata
2020 Hyundai Sonata

You may not have expected to see two Hyundai models on this list, but the 2020 Hyundai Sonata makes a strong case as a class leader in the competitive midsize sedan segment. Its redesign brought with it a stunning new look, a roomy, premium interior, and a generous list of standard features, plus some interesting available tech when you get into the higher trims like remote parking assist that helps with tight parking spaces. That’s a feature you’d normally expect to see in a much more expensive luxury car. The 2020 Hyundai Sonata is offered as a hybrid as well.

2020 Chevrolet Corvette

2020 Chevrolet Corvette C8
2020 Chevrolet Corvette

The 2020 Chevrolet Corvette C8 is a huge milestone for the legendary nameplate. The basic formula of the Corvette has been unchanged for decades as a two-seater sports car with a V8 in the front powering the rear wheels. However, the formula has changed in a big way with the 2020 redesign, with the engine finally moving behind the driver in a mid-engine configuration that’s been rumored for almost all of Corvette’s history.

2020 Ford Expedition

2020 Ford Expedition

The 2020 Ford Expedition is the only car on this list that is not an all-new model or a full redesign for 2020. That’s because we wanted to put a full-size SUV on this list and there just aren’t any all-new ones for 2020 since this segment only has a handful of players. The Expedition got a big redesign for 2018 and it’s been aging tremendously well ever since as a roomy and capable family hauler.

2020 Honda CR-V Hybrid

2020 Honda CR-V Hybrid

The 2020 Honda CR-V ranks among the leaders of the compact SUV class. Its passenger and cargo volumes eclipse those of most rivals, and its well-balanced ride and capable powertrain make it a great daily drive

Honda has discontinued the LX’s former lethargic non-turbocharged engine and equipped it with the turbocharged 1.5-liter four-cylinder that in the past was reserved for the CR-V’s more expensive trim levels. The CR-V’s suite of safety features is also standard for 2020, meaning even the most affordable CR-V provides adaptive cruise control and the latest crash prevention technology. Sleeker styling and improved interior storage are also part of Honda’s 2020 updates.

2020 Nissan Sentra

2020 Nissan Sentra Prices, and Pictures in Nigeria
2020 Nissan Sentra

The 2020 Nissan Sentra is all-new, with styling that matches other recently unveiled Nissans such as the Altima and Rogue. The same V-Motion family grille, slim headlights, and a floating roof are all here with the Sentra. A new platform lowers the car while a slightly more powerful 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ine replaces the outgoing 1.8-liter. The new mill makes 149 horsepower, and it pairs with a CVT. Nissan’s Safety Shield 360 is also standard.
